Click here to see work in progress , Bibliography of Theban West Bank Archaeological Sites offers over 5,000 references that describe tombs in the Valley of the Kings, Valley of the Queens, outlying wadis and the Tombs of the Nobles, plus all the memorial temples, shrines, villages, graffiti, predynastic remains, and Christian sites. We will regularly update the Bibliography of Theban West Bank Archaeological Sites , and we hope to add a search engine to make it an even more useful tool in the near future. http://www.thebanmappingproject.com/
